St Johns station makes ticketing hassle-free with several options available for passengers. A ticket office is open from Monday to Friday, 07:10 to 13:50. Besides, ticket machines, including those accessible on the platforms, are available for purchasing tickets and collecting those booked online. For smart travelers, smartcards are both issued and validated at the station.
Although the station lacks some facilities like luggage storage and refreshment options, travelers can rely on excellent help and support. There's a help point for immediate assistance, while customer help points are scattered throughout the station. The station is well-monitored with CCTV, ensuring passenger security. Moreover, the Southeastern Customer Services can be contacted for lost property, providing a helpful service whenever needed.
Despite its limited step-free access, various options ensure a smooth transit experience. While wheelchairs aren’t available, ramps for train access are provided. Although parking facilities are limited and the station lacks accessible spaces, assistance for those with mobility impairments can be arranged by contacting the Call Centre ahead of travel.
For those seeking further travel via bus, comprehensive information on onward journeys can be found online. When rail replacements are necessary, designated bus stops ensure connectivity towards nearby locations such as New Cross and Lewisham, with helpful information available through services like "what 3 words" for precise location details.

The station is equipped with various facilities to ease your journey. For those purchasing tickets on-site, the Ticket Office is open Monday to Friday from 06:45 to 13:15, and on Saturday from 08:10 to 14:40. Ticket machines are available for flexibility, and online purchased tickets can be collected effortlessly at the machines. Accessibility is a key consideration, with accessible machines and an induction loop available. However, smartcards are not issued here.
Help and support facilities are available, with staff assistance provided during the Ticket Office hours. There are also useful customer help points scattered throughout the station, and for those needing further assistance, information is provided through both departure screens and announcements. If you've left something behind or need a bit of extra help, ScotRail offers a dedicated lost property service, operational from 07:00 to 21:00 daily.
Markinch Station shines when it comes to accessibility. A Category A station, it offers step-free access to all platforms, making it easy for passengers with mobility issues to navigate their way around. However, it’s advised to take note of the more pronounced stepping distance between the platform and train on Platform 1. There are no accessible taxis directly at the station, so planning ahead is recommended if required.
Though there are no accessible toilets or baby changing facilities, standard toilets are available on Platform 2 during Ticket Office hours. A waiting room and seating areas ensure comfort while you await your departure.
Finding your next transit point from Markinch Station is straightforward. A bus turning point, right in front of the station, ensures that rail replacement buses and local bus services are well connected. For more detailed information, sites like Traveline Scotland can offer insights on local bus timings and routes. If you're considering taking a taxi, TrainTaxi provides convenient details of available services.
